‘Godzilla vs. Kong’ Director on Staging Epic Monster Battles, Rebooting ‘Face/Off’

Adam Wingard left it all on the field.Despite the challenges of setting up an epic fight between two of the most famous monsters in movie history, the “Godzilla vs. Kong” director insists that there isn’t some four-hour long, Snyder Cut version just waiting to be released. So sorry kaiju fans, the film that will premiere in theaters and on HBO Max on March 31 is the director’s cut.
